Portland Magazine Product Description Fasttalking gem expert Lonny Cushman encounters the dangerous and malevolent world of the African gem industry as he accompanies a young female seminarian from New York to Rwanda in search of her missing father. Once they reach Africa, Lonny chases a collection of flawless green diamonds through the killing fields of the Congo. Their survival depends upon negotiating the bloody network of the conflictridden African diamond trade, including Islamic jihadists, corrupt military officers, Israeli agents, Ukrainian arms dealers, and a whole host of con men. Can Lonny save himself and the young seminarian from a tragic demise? About the Author John B. Robinson isthe author of The Sapphire Sea and a tour guide at Mount Kilimanjaro who has bought, sold, and traded rare gems.He lives in Portland, Maine.
